Airport Terminal Layout
LGA Airport is divided into four terminals: Terminal A, Terminal B, Terminal C, and Terminal D. Each terminal is designed to cater to a specific set of airlines and destinations. Terminal A is used exclusively by Delta Air Lines, while Terminal B is home to American Airlines and Southwest Airlines. Terminal C is used by various airlines, including JetBlue and United Airlines, and Terminal D is used by Delta Air Lines and WestJet.
Overview of Terminals
Terminal A at the airport is the smallest of the four terminals, with only nine gates. It is exclusively used by Delta Air Lines for its shuttle service to Boston, Chicago, and Washington, D.C. Terminal B is the largest terminal at the airport, with 35 gates, and is used by American Airlines and Southwest Airlines. Terminal C has 29 gates and is used by various airlines, including JetBlue and United Airlines. Terminal D has 21 gates and is used by Delta Air Lines and WestJet.
Getting Between Terminals
LaGuardia provides a free shuttle bus service called the "Route A" shuttle that runs between all four terminals. The shuttle operates 24/7 and runs every 8-10 minutes during peak hours and every 15-20 minutes during off-peak hours. Passengers can also walk between Terminal B and Terminal C via a covered walkway that takes approximately 5-10 minutes.
Food, Shops & Services
LGA offers a wide range of food and shopping options for travelers. Terminal B is the main hub for food and shopping, with a variety of restaurants and cafes to choose from. Grab a quick bite at Dunkin' Donuts or Starbucks, or sit down for a meal at Bowery Bay Tavern or La Chula. For those looking for a healthier option, there's also a Fresh & Co. and a Cibo Express Gourmet Market.
In addition to food and shopping, La Guardia Airport also offers a variety of amenities for travelers. Need to freshen up before your flight? Head to one of the airport's many restrooms or take advantage of the shower facilities in Terminal B. There are also plenty of charging stations throughout the airport, so you can keep your devices powered up while you wait for your flight.
If you're in need of some last-minute shopping, Terminal B has you covered with a variety of shops selling everything from clothing and accessories to electronics and souvenirs. And if you need to exchange currency, there are several currency exchange booths located throughout the airport.
